WebIf you start with $25,000 in a savings account earning a 7% interest rate, compounded monthly, and make $500 deposits on a monthly basis, after 15 years your savings account will have grown to $230,629-- of which $115,000 is the total of your beginning balance plus deposits, and $115,629 is the total interest earnings. crystal reports field mapping https://insursmith.com

To stay on track to retire at 67, you should have saved 3 times your income by age 40, according to retirement-plan provider Fidelity Investments. This guideline doesn’t just include cash... WebAug 27, 2024 · Fidelity's guideline: Aim to save at least 1x your salary by 30, 3x by 40, 6x by 50, 8x by 60, and 10x by 67. Factors that will impact your personal savings goal include the age you plan to retire and the lifestyle you hope to have in retirement. If you're behind, don't fret. There are ways to catch up. The key is to take action.
